The base game does not include the Toyota FJ Cruiser. To drive it, you must rely on third-party mods. Quality varies wildly—from $10 Patreon exclusives with realistic tire flex to free rip-offs with broken collision meshes.

The 4.0L V6 engine, producing roughly 239 to 260 horsepower, isn't about top-end speed but "low-end grunt". This makes the FJ Cruiser a favorite for community-made trails and free-roam maps where climbing and crawling take precedence over lap times. The Appeal of the Unconventional
